Ayatul Kursi

اللَّهُ لَا إِلَٰهَ إِلَّا هُوَ الْحَيُّ الْقَيُّومُ ۚ لَا تَأْخُذُهُ سِنَةٌ وَلَا نَوْمٌ ۚ لَهُ مَا فِي السَّمَاوَاتِ وَمَا فِي الْأَرْضِ ۗ مَنْ ذَا الَّذِي يَشْفَعُ عِنْدَهُ إِلَّا بِإِذْنِهِ ۚ يَعْلَمُ مَا بَيْنَ أَيْدِيهِمْ وَمَا خَلْفَهُمْ ۖ وَلَا يُحِيطُونَ بِشَيْءٍ مِنْ عِلْمِهِ إِلَّا بِمَا شَاءَ ۚ وَسِعَ كُرْسِيُّهُ السَّمَاوَاتِ وَالْأَرْضَ ۖ وَلَا يَئُودُهُ حِفْظُهُمَا ۚ وَهُوَ الْعَلِيُّ الْعَظِيمُ ﴿٢٥٥﴾ البقرة ٢٥٥

Allah, there is no god except He, the Living, the Everlasting. Neither slumber overtakes Him, nor sleep. To Him belongs whatsoever is in the heavens and whatsoever is on earth. Who is there who can intercede with Him without His permission? He knows what is ahead of them, and what is behind them; and they cannot grasp any of His Knowledge, except as He wills. His Throne extends over the heavens and the earth, and their preservation does not burden Him. He is the Most-High, the Tremendous. Q 2:255

References:

Ubayy b. Ka'b narrated that Messenger of Allah ﷺ said: O Abu Mundhir, do you know the verse from the Book of Allah which, according to you, is the greatest? I said: Allah and His Apostle ﷺ know best. He again said: O Abu Mundhir, do you know the verse from the Book of Allah which, according to you, is the greatest? I said: [Above ayat]. Thereupon he ﷺ patted me in the chest and said: Rejoice by this knowledge, O Abu Mundhir! - Muslim, 810 (Sahih)


Abu Umamah narrated that the Messenger of Allah ﷺ said: Whoever reads [Above ayat] after every obligatory prayer, there is nothing that will prevent him from entering Paradise except death. - an-Nasai Sunan Kubra, 9848 (Hasan), Tabarani, 8068 (Sahih)


Narrated Abu Huraira: Allah's Apostle ﷺ deputed me to keep Sadaqat (al-Fitr) of Ramadan. A comer came and started taking (stealthily) handfuls of the foodstuff (of the Sadaqa). I took hold of him and said: By Allah, I will take you to Allah's Apostle. He said: I am needy and have many dependents, and I am in great need. I released him, and in the morning Allah's Apostle asked me: What did your prisoner do yesterday? I said: O Allah's Apostle! The person complained of being needy and of having many dependents, so, I pitied him and let him go. Allah's Apostle ﷺ said: Indeed, he told you a lie and he will be coming again. I believed that he would show up again as Allah's Apostle had told me that he would return. So, I waited for him watchfully… When he showed up and started stealing for the third time, he said: (Forgive me and) I will teach you some words with which Allah will benefit you. I asked: What are they? He replied: Whenever you go to bed, recite Ayatul Kursi till you finish the whole verse. (If you do so), Allah will appoint a guard for you who will stay with you and no Satan will come near you till morning. So, I released him. In the morning, Allah's Apostle asked: What did your prisoner do yesterday? I replied: He claimed that he would teach me some words by which Allah will benefit me, so I let him go. Allah's Apostle asked: What are they? I replied: He said to me: Whenever you go to bed, recite Ayatul Kursi from the beginning to the end. He further said to me: (If you do so), Allah will appoint a guard for you who will stay with you, and no Satan will come near you till morning. The Prophet ﷺ said: He really spoke the truth, although he is an absolute liar. Do you know whom you were talking to, these three nights, O Abu Huraira? Abu Huraira said: No. He said: It was Satan. - al-Bukhari, 2311 (Sahih)
